Met Office Update on volcanic plume

Barbados Meteorological Services said this evening that the La Soufriere Volcano continued to remain highly active. However, there had been a shift in the upper-level winds which had redirected most of the volcanic plume further north of Barbados.

The next update will be at noon on April 10 or sooner if conditions warrant.

The University of the West Indies Seismic Rsearch Centre recorded three explosive eruptions today, the first of which was at 8:41 a.m. followed by another around 2:45 p.m. and the third at 6:35 p.m. (PR/KG)
